Serving 604 students in grades 6-8, John Glenn Middle School ranks in the top 20% of all schools in Massachusetts for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 20%, and reading proficiency is top 20%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 65% (which is higher than the Massachusetts state average of 42%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 68% (which is higher than the Massachusetts state average of 44%).
The student-teacher ratio of 10:1 is lower than the Massachusetts state level of 12:1.
Minority enrollment is 44% of the student body (majority Asian), which is lower than the Massachusetts state average of 49% (majority Hispanic and Black).

School Overview

John Glenn Middle School's student population of 604 students has stayed relatively flat over five school years.
The teacher population of 59 teachers has grown by 5% over five school years.
